Add co-hosts to your home listing

If you need extra support hosting your place, you can add a family member, friend, or neighbor as a co-host. Or you can find an experienced local host to help you manage your home on the Co-Host Network (where available).*

A co-host can be invited to an individual home listing by the listing owner or a full access co-host, while only listing owners can invite a co-host to multiple home listings at the same time.

Invite co-hosts to a single listing

Invite co-host to a single listing on desktop

  1. Click Listings and select the listing you want to edit
  2. Under Listing editor, click Co-hosts
  3. Under Invite a co-host, click Get started
  4. Add their country/region and phone number or email address, then click Next
  5. Select the permissions that are right for this co-host and click Next
  6. Review and click Send

Invite a co-host to multiple listings at the same time

Invite a co-host to multiple listings at the same time on desktop

  1. Click Listings
  2. Select the tick box next to each listing you want to include
  3. Click Co-hosts
  4. Under Invite a co-host, click Get started
  5. Add their country/region and phone number or email address and click Next
  6. Select the permissions that are right for this co-host and click Next
  7. Review and click Send


You can invite up to 10 co-hosts per listing. When adding a co-host to multiple listings at the same time, the co-host permissions you choose must be the same for all listings. You can change a co-host’s permissions on an individual listing at any time.

Work with an experienced local host

In some countries, you can work with an experienced local host who can help you manage your home.* You can stay in control of your listing while getting the help you need. Find a co-host on the Co-Host Network and start discussing how you’ll collaborate.

Find an experienced local host on the Co-Host Network

Find a local co-host on desktop

  1. Click Listings and select the listing you want to edit
  2. Under Listing editor, click Your space
  3. Click Co-hosts and then click Find someone to help
  4. Click Submit a new request. You can also choose to browse local co-hosts to see who’s available in your area
  5. Select your listing and click Next
  6. Choose either Full-service support or individual services that you need help with
  7. Click Next
  8. Write a short description of your hosting needs and click Next
  9. Click Submit

Your request will be sent to local co-hosts. If they’re interested, they’ll reply in Messages. Then you can review their profile and message with them directly to see if it’s a good fit.

Where the Co-Host Network is available

The Co-Host Network is currently available in Australia, France, Germany, Italy, Japan, Mexico, Puerto Rico, South Korea, Spain, and the United Kingdom (powered by Airbnb Global Services); Canada, the United States (powered by Airbnb Living LLC); and Brazil (powered by Airbnb Plataforma Digital Ltda).

*Hosts within the Co-Host Network typically have high ratings, low cancellation rates, and established Airbnb hosting experience. Ratings are based on guest reviews for listings they host or co-host and may not represent the co-host’s unique services.
